Name released of man shot, killed by Arkansas officer

     (AP) – Police have identified a man who was shot and killed by an

off-duty police officer during a bank robbery as a 58-year-old Grant County man.

     Police in Benton say the man had demanded money at gunpoint at a First Simmons

Bank Friday afternoon when the officer intervened in the attempted robbery and

shot Joseph Edward Turner Jr.

     Turner later died at a hospital.

     No other injuries are reported.

     The officer’s name hasn’t been released. Police spokesman Matt Burks said the

officer is on paid leave pending an investigation.

     The shooting is the third officer-involved fatal shooting in Benton in two

months.
